    Thanks for sharing your experience Brad. I haven’t been bow hunting nearly as long. In my own experience I’ve found the perfect balance for me is about 440-460gn out of a 28” DL 70lb bow. I have had a couple not pass through but that was because I buried them into the thickest part of the scapula with mechanicals on quartering away shots. I used 550gn for a season and had a few instances that led me to reduce my arrow weight back to 440-460. I do a fair amount of stalk hunting on public land and a lot of my shots are 30yds+. Had multiple deer not only jump my arrow with the heavy setup, but had enough time to completely dodge the arrow. The velocity difference was substantial.
